summary refs log tree commit diff
diff options
context:
space:
mode:
authorErik Johnston <erik@matrix.org>2014-09-15 17:43:46 +0100
committerErik Johnston <erik@matrix.org>2014-09-15 17:43:46 +0100
commit1e4b971f95ac953e9fbd4a8e4cc0d0d2edc5e5ea (patch)
treebfb15c6b17b54e44957e65bc8f4a5f3ea334aa64
parentFix bug where we incorrectly calculated 'age_ts' from 'age' key rather than t... (diff)
downloadsynapse-1e4b971f95ac953e9fbd4a8e4cc0d0d2edc5e5ea.tar.xz
Fix bug where we didn't always get 'prev_content' key
-rw-r--r--synapse/api/events/__init__.py5
1 files changed, 1 insertions, 4 deletions
diff --git a/synapse/api/events/__init__.py b/synapse/api/events/__init__.py
index add81ec3e6..a9991e9c94 100644
--- a/synapse/api/events/__init__.py
+++ b/synapse/api/events/__init__.py
@@ -57,6 +57,7 @@ class SynapseEvent(JsonEncodedObject):
         "state_key",
         "required_power_level",
         "age_ts",
+        "prev_content",
     ]
 
     internal_keys = [
@@ -172,10 +173,6 @@ class SynapseEvent(JsonEncodedObject):
 
 class SynapseStateEvent(SynapseEvent):
 
-    valid_keys = SynapseEvent.valid_keys + [
-        "prev_content",
-    ]
-
     def __init__(self, **kwargs):
         if "state_key" not in kwargs:
             kwargs["state_key"] = ""